**Colliders Library Functions**
=============================
####**Physics:AddCollider([name,] collider)**
#### **Physics:AddCollider([name,] collider)**
This function is used for creating a collider without a profile without being tied to any particular unit. The "name" parameter is optional, but must be unique if given. Collider follows the standard collider format as given in the Collider Format section. Returns the registered collider for additional modification/reference.

####**Physics:ColliderFromProfile(profileName[, collider])**
#### **Physics:ColliderFromProfile(profileName[, collider])**
This function is used to create a new collider from the given collider profile name. The profile name must match a registered profile. Returns a copy of the collider profile modified with the properties passed in for the 'collider' table if given.

####**Physics:CreateColliderProfile(profileName, profile)**
#### **Physics:CreateColliderProfile(profileName, profile)**
This function is used to create and register a new collider profile for the given profile name. This registered collider profile can then be used to create new colliders using the profile collider table as a base.

####**Physics:RemoveCollider(name)**
#### **Physics:RemoveCollider(name)**
This function removes a collider by name from the Physics API so that it is no longer processed.


**PhysicsUnit Functions**
=============================
A unit which has been converted to a Physics Unit can have a collider attached to it and managed using the following functions:

####**AddCollider([name,] collider)**
#### **AddCollider([name,] collider)**
This function can be called to add a collider (in the correct Collider Format) to the unit. An optional name can be given, or a unique name will be used. The resulting collider will be returned for further adjustment/management.

####**AddColliderFromProfile([name,] profile, [collider])**
#### **AddColliderFromProfile([name,] profile, [collider])**
This function can be called to add a collider from a registered collider profile to this unit. The profile must be provided, as can an optional name or collider properties table. The resulting collider will be returned for further adjustment/management.

####**GetColliders()**
#### **GetColliders()**
Returns a table of all colliders attached to this unit in {name=colliderTable} format.

####**GetMass()**
#### **GetMass()**
Returns the mass of this unit for use in "momentum" collider calculations. The default mass is set to 100.

####**RemoveCollider(name)**
#### **RemoveCollider(name)**
This function can be called to remove a collider by name from this unit. The collider will also be removed from the Physics API.

####**SetMass(mass)**
#### **SetMass(mass)**
Sets the mass of this unit for use in "momentum" collider calculations.

**Built-in Collider Profiles**
=============================
##**COLLIDER_SPHERE**
## **COLLIDER_SPHERE**

###**blocker**
### **blocker**
A blocker collider blocks out either the colliding unit or the collider-attached unit whenever a successful collision is found. Can affect non-Physics units.

###**gravity**
### **gravity**
A gravity collider applies a force to any colliding unit attracting it towards the collider-attached unit with a given force and function.

###**reflect**
### **reflect**
A reflect collider applies a reflection force using the incident vector of collision with the collider sphere to redirect the velocity of the colliding unit. Additionally can act as a blocker.

###**momentum**
### **momentum**
A momentum collider applies a force to the colliding unit and collider-attached unit in accordance with their mass as set on their Physics Unit settings. The elasticity coefficient of the collision can be set. Additionally can act as a blocker.
